Charlie doesn’t do aerobic work like you are thinking. His athletes never run more than 1500 meters at one time. Although, on “Tempo” days, they will do numerous runs (100m-400m) for a total of 1500-2500m for the entire workout. He also uses a variety of ab exercises with the medicine ball and bodyweight exercises for a warm-up or in between runs. You should get his book “Training for Speed.” It’s quite good.
